Folks, I just installed Banshee 1.0 and I like it, but I'm wondering if it's possible to move the default Podcasts directory?

I ask because I'd rather not have it in /home as I do auto-backups of /home many times a day and would rather have the podcasts on the same, un-backed-up external drive that my Music, Pictures, etc. are located.  I did try looking through gconf-editor but I couldn't find a key for this option.

Is this possible?

It looks like the Podcast directory is placed in a sub-directory named Podcasts in the Music directory by default.  I didn't look too in depth but seems like the magic happens on or around line 80 here http://svn.gnome.org/viewvc/banshee/trunk/banshee/src/Extensions/Banshee.Podcasting/Banshee.Podcasting/PodcastService.cs?view=annotate.  Is there a way to link directly to a line in the repository?

I like this idea a lot.  Would this make sense?

1.  In the Tools/Preferences tab add an additional dialog tab for
"Files"
2.  Allow the user to configure paths for...
    a.  Music
    b.  Podcasts
    c.  Movies/Video podcasts
    d.  Coverart
3.  The default would be to have them cascaded under the Music folder.
4.  We could even consider a "Backup..." button?
